Working Apartment Complex Fire

Wednesday, July 12, 2017

On Wednesday June 28th, 2017, the Dover Fire Department was dispatched to a report of a working structure fire in building "B" of the Towne Point Apartments. Additional calls began coming in to DFD dispatch reporting subjects trapped in an apartment, also on the 3rd floor of that building. Engine 6 arrived on location to find smoke showing from the alpha side (front) 3rd floor of a 3 story apartment building with Dover PD confirming a subject trapped on the 3rd floor charlie side (rear). The crew from the Engine secured a water supply, threw ground ladders and stretched an attack line to the 3rd floor. After a quick search, a female victim was located and rescued from the apartment adjacent to the one that was on fire. There were a total of three civilians injured as a result of the fire, one of which was transported to the hospital (condition is unknown). Additional crews from Ladder 2, Utility 1, Engine 4, Engine 3, Ladder and Engine 54 (Little Creek) and Ambulance 41 (Camden) assisted in victim removal, search, fire suppression and overhaul. Fire Chief Buck Carey placed the scene under control and it was turned over to the City FM for investigation.
